The Bottleneck You Can’t Afford: Manual Resume Screening and Candidate Engagement

Consider the sheer volume of applications a typical recruitment team handles. Each resume represents potential, but also a significant time investment for review. Manually sifting through hundreds, sometimes thousands, of CVs to identify qualified candidates is not just tedious; it’s a productivity black hole. Add to this the manual process of sending initial communications, scheduling follow-up calls, and tracking candidate progress through spreadsheets or fragmented systems, and you begin to see why recruiters often feel overwhelmed. This low-value, repetitive work consumes valuable hours that could be better spent on direct candidate engagement, building talent pipelines, or developing more effective sourcing strategies.

Beyond the Obvious: Impact on Candidate Experience and Quality of Hire

The consequences of manual recruitment operations extend far beyond internal productivity. A slow, unresponsive hiring process directly impacts the candidate experience. Top-tier candidates, often in high demand, are unlikely to wait patiently through a drawn-out, clunky process. Delays in communication, clashing schedules, and a lack of transparency can lead to lost talent, especially when competitors offer a more agile and professional experience. Furthermore, when recruiters are bogged down in administrative tasks, their ability to conduct thorough assessments, build rapport, and make truly informed hiring decisions can suffer, ultimately compromising the quality of hire and the long-term success of the organization.

The Illusion of Control: Why Spreadsheets and Legacy Systems Fail

Many organizations attempt to manage their recruitment operations with a patchwork of spreadsheets, email clients, and perhaps an outdated applicant tracking system (ATS) that doesn’t fully integrate with other tools. This creates an illusion of control. While each tool might serve a small purpose, their inability to communicate seamlessly leads to data silos, duplicate entry, and a constant risk of human error. Information gets lost, candidates fall through the cracks, and reporting becomes a nightmare. Recruiters spend more time chasing data than they do engaging with people, creating an environment that stifles efficiency and scalability. Without a single source of truth, strategic insights are hard to come by, and proactive decision-making becomes reactive firefighting.

Data Silos and Disjointed Workflows: The Scalability Killer

As a business grows, so does its need for talent. Manual processes that were merely inefficient at a smaller scale become critical impediments to growth. The inability of disparate systems to share data and trigger automated workflows means that every increase in hiring volume multiplies the manual effort exponentially. This bottleneck prevents businesses from scaling effectively, forcing them to either compromise on the speed of hiring or hire more administrative staff simply to manage the process, rather than the candidates. A lack of integrated workflows for tasks like background checks, offer letter generation, and onboarding further exacerbates this issue, turning what should be an exciting new hire experience into a fragmented administrative burden.
